The church in Cuba has a most amazing understanding of Christianity. According to them if a Christian church does not have daughter churches it is barren!Each month (the) team of 400 people is leading some 15,000 people to Christ.One of the great highlights of (this past) year in Cuba was to be able to gather our four hundred workers in a camp in Santa Clara. The workers were able to meet the entire team for the first time. There was wonderful fellowship, great Bible teaching, and the event was the only one of its kind.Another wonderful highlight related to this event was the permit by the communist party. The permit for transportation of so many workers, the permit for the pastoral staff from the U.S and the permit to gather in the camp were all granted quickly by the central communist party.Even as Mr. Castro's health wanes, his brother Raul, a family man, is poised to take control and to lead the country through its upcoming transition.
